WebDec 15, 2024 · The Most Important Port In Spain Located in the southwestern corner of the Iberian Peninsula, between the Mediterranean Sea and the Atlantic Sea, Cádiz became … Port of Spain , officially the City of Port of Spain (also stylized Port-of-Spain), is the capital of Trinidad and Tobago and the third largest municipality, after Chaguanas and San Fernando. The city has a municipal population of 37,074 (2011 census), an urban population of 81,142 (2011 estimate) and a transient daily population of 250,000. Port of Spain replaced St. Joseph as the capital in 1757. The city was built around a harbour protected by the western hills of the Northern Range. Its residential communities and suburbs fan out to the valleys and hills around. shangri-la group ceoWebFeb 18, 2024 · The bustling capital of Trinidad, Port of Spain, is an exciting city that intricately blends ancient and modern worlds and… Taking safety measures Free cancellation from $41.00 per adult Reserve 6.
